Yield: 4 servings
Cream cheese and milk replace the heavy cream in this classic, velvety smooth pasta sauce flavored with Parmesan cheese.
Special Extra
Prepare as directed, heating 1 pkg. (6 oz.) OSCAR MAYER Grilled or Italian Style Chicken Breast Strips with the sauce before tossing with the pasta.
I substituted the regular cream cheese with neufachel (reduced fat) cream cheese. Not only did it bring the overall fat content down, but I couldn't really tell a difference. I also used 1 percent milk for another low fat option. I didn't know if skim would give me the right consistency or not, so I stuck with 1 percent.
Most of the other alfredo recipes I've tried used heavy cream. This one was pretty good overall for a healthier and pretty easy recipe. Not the best alfredo I've had, but good for the amount of effort to make.

This was a very easy recipe and very quick. I didn't have much time, and I don't like to cook often, but this was easy. A little more milk to make it a little creamier because it seems creamy when you are making the sauce but once it is mixed with the pasta it is a little dryer than it should be. And a little garlic salt mixed in with the garlic powder can help also... Overall, I'll make it again and next time it will be better!
